Connecting the Workstation to an SGI Origin 3000
Server That Has L2 Controller Hardware
This section describes how to connect a Silicon Graphics 230 visual
workstation to the Ethernet port (ENET port) of the SGI Origin 3000 series
server L2 controller. If you have a server system with multiple L2
controllers, you can connect the workstation to an Ethernet hub to which
the multiple L2 controllers are connected.
To connect the workstation to an L2 controller, follow these steps:
1. Make sure that the SGI Origin 3000 series server, the L2 controller,
and the workstation are powered off.
2. If your server does not have an Ethernet hub, connect the
workstation to the ENET connector on the L2 controller with a
crossover Ethernet cable (see Figure 7).
If your server has an Ethernet hub, connect the workstation to the
leftmost port on the Ethernet hub. Connect one end of standard
Ethernet cable to the ENET port on the L2 controller and connect the
other end to a port on the Ethernet hub (see Figure 7).
